Output e661f4b672e8d78d9d879270ffb88f71b020e43299409ebb8c7f541a10efbaf4:1

value
34188822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b23fdb937382b0b94dcc70bfa022402a54f5d0 OP_EQUAL
address
3Bxu91xLtdXXNsZpgVbcZ6t1WMf9hXhH2T
transaction
e661f4b672e8d78d9d879270ffb88f71b020e43299409ebb8c7f541a10efbaf4
confirmations
503559
spent
true